Q: Is 54,252,252 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 54,252,252 is not a prime number.

Why is 54,252,252 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 54252252 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 9 12 18 36 1,507,007 3,014,014 4,521,021 6,028,028 9,042,042 13,563,063 18,084,084 27,126,126 and 54,252,252, with no remainder.

Since 54,252,252 cannot be divided by just 1 and 54,252,252, it is not a prime number.
